Frequently asked questions
Ownership history, including the number of previous owners and how long they owned the vehicle, can indicate how well the 2005 HONDA vehicle was maintained, if such records are available.
Accident history may include reports of any collisions the 2005 HONDA ACCORD has been involved in, detailing the extent of damage and subsequent repairs, if such incidents are documented.
The depreciation rate can be influenced by factors such as the vehicle's condition, mileage, market demand, and the pace of technological advancements in newer models.
To ensure the 2005 HONDA ACCORD meets environmental standards, look for emissions ratings and fuel economy data on the window sticker, which indicate compliance with environmental regulations.
A 2005 HONDA ACCORD window sticker includes information such as MSRP, fuel efficiency, safety ratings, and optional equipment.
Yes, it is generally safe to share your VIN online for decoding, as the VIN is a public figure and does not contain sensitive personal information.
Repossession records, if included, indicate if the 2005 HONDA vehicle has been taken back by a lender due to payment defaults, which might affect its condition and value.
The Monroney label helps you understand the added features on a 2005 HONDA ACCORD by listing optional equipment and packages included in the vehicle, along with their pricing.
